Charlie Chaplin and A Woman of Paris: The Genesis of a Misunderstood Masterpiece

Wes D. Gehring
4.9/5 (22827 ratings)
Description:Charlie Chaplin's A Woman of Paris (1923) was a groundbreaking film which was neither a simple recycling of Peggy Hopkins Joyce's story, nor quickly forgotten. Through heavily-documented period research, this book lands several bombshells, including Paris is deeply rooted in Chaplin's previous films and his relationship with Edna Purviance, Paris was not rejected by heartland America, Chaplin did romantic research (especially with Pola Negri), and Paris' many ongoing influences have never been fully appreciated.
